PS 1397 - 19TH CENTURY EUROPEAN POLITICAL HISTORY


Minimum Credits: 3
Maximum Credits: 3
Through readings, lectures, and discussions, students will understand and analyze major political developments in Europe between the French Revolution and World War I. Focus includes major political thinkers, from Locke to Marx, and major political events that transformed Europe in the 19th century.
